Best Cancer hospitals in the USA

Here are some of the top cancer hospitals in the USA and their key features:

1. MD Anderson Cancer Center (Houston, Texas)

  • Rank: Often ranked as the #1 cancer hospital in the U.S.
  • Key Features:
    • Comprehensive Care: MD Anderson offers specialized care for all types of cancer, with multidisciplinary teams focused on each individual case.
    • Innovative Treatments: Pioneering work in cancer immunotherapy, radiation therapy, and clinical trials.
    • Patient-Centered Approach: Highly personalized treatment plans that focus on the patient’s needs, including physical, emotional, and social well-being.
    • Clinical Trials: Leading in cancer research, with numerous clinical trials offering access to cutting-edge treatments.
    • Specialty Centers: Specialized centers for various cancer types, including breast cancer, lung cancer, and neuro-oncology.

2.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(New York City, New York)

  • Rank: Consistently ranked among the top cancer hospitals in the U.S.
  • Key Features:
    • World-Class Research: MSKCC is at the forefront of cancer research and clinical trials, offering patients access to experimental therapies.
    • Specialized Care: Expertise in a wide range of cancers, from pediatric to adult oncology.
    • Advanced Treatment: Utilizes the latest techniques in surgery, chemotherapy, immunotherapy, and radiation.
    • Multidisciplinary Approach: Teams of specialists, including oncologists, surgeons, and radiologists, collaborate to create personalized treatment plans.
    • Patient Support: Comprehensive support services, including psychosocial counseling, nutrition support, and survivorship care.

9. City of Hope National Medical Center (Duarte, California)

  • Rank: Highly ranked for cancer treatment, especially in hematology and blood cancers.
  • Key Features:
    • Leading Blood Cancer Center: Specializes in treating hematologic cancers like leukemia, lymphoma, and myeloma.
    • Stem Cell Transplant Program: City of Hope is known for its pioneering stem cell transplant program for patients with blood cancers.
    • Innovative Research: Focuses on cutting-edge treatments, including immunotherapy and CAR T-cell therapy.
    • Comprehensive Care: Offers a full range of services, including surgery, radiation therapy, chemotherapy, and supportive care.
    • Patient-Centered Approach: Emphasizes individualized treatment plans with a focus on the patient’s quality of life.
